Item 4.01 - Change in Registrant’s Certifying Accountant.

On October 13, 2021, the audit committee of the board of directors of KORE Group Holdings, Inc., a Delaware corporation (the “Company”) approved the engagement of BDO USA, LLP (“BDO”) as the Company’s independent registered public accounting firm to audit the Company’s consolidated financial statements for the year ended December 31, 2021. BDO served as the independent registered public accounting firm of Maple Holdings Inc. prior to the business combination between the Company and Cerberus Telecom Acquisition Corp., a Delaware corporation (“CTAC”) (the “Merger”). Accordingly, WithumSmith+Brown, PC (“Withum”), the Company’s and CTAC’s independent registered public accounting firm prior to the Merger, was informed that it would be replaced by BDO as the Company’s independent registered public accounting firm.

Withum’s audit reports on the financial statements of CTAC for the period from September 8, 2020 (inception) through December 31, 2020 and the financial statements of the Company as of March 31, 2021, did not provide an adverse opinion or disclaimer of opinion to the Company’s financial statements, nor modify its opinion as to uncertainty, audit scope or accounting principles.

As of March 31, 2021, and the subsequent interim period through October 13, 2021, there were: (i) no disagreements within the meaning of Item 304(a)(1)(iv) of Regulation S-K and the related instructions between the Company and Withum on any matters of accounting principles or practices, financial statement disclosure, or auditing scope or procedure which, if not resolved to Withum’s satisfaction, would have caused Withum to make reference thereto in their reports; and (ii) no “reportable events” within the meaning of Item 304(a)(1)(v) of Regulation S-K.

The Company provided Withum with a copy of the foregoing disclosures and has requested that Withum furnish the Company with a letter addressed to the SEC stating whether it agrees with the statements made by the Company set forth above. A copy of Withum’s letter, dated October 19, 2021, is filed as Exhibit 16.1 to this Report.
